性能指标在产品迭代过程中的关键作用是什么?
在产品迭代过程中,性能指标扮演着至关重要的角色。它们不仅是衡量产品性能的标准,更是指导产品改进和优化的关键依据。本文将深入探讨性能指标在产品迭代过程中的关键作用,并结合实际案例进行分析。
一、性能指标的定义及类型
性能指标是指用于衡量产品在特定条件下表现出来的各项指标,包括但不限于响应时间、吞吐量、并发用户数、资源利用率等。根据不同的应用场景,性能指标可以分为以下几类:
- 响应时间:指用户发起请求到系统返回响应的时间,是衡量系统响应速度的重要指标。
- 吞吐量:指系统在单位时间内处理请求的数量,是衡量系统处理能力的重要指标。
- 并发用户数:指同时在线的用户数量,是衡量系统承载能力的重要指标。
- 资源利用率:指系统在运行过程中,各项资源(如CPU、内存、磁盘等)的利用率,是衡量系统性能的重要指标。
二、性能指标在产品迭代过程中的关键作用
- 发现产品瓶颈
在产品迭代过程中,通过收集和分析性能指标,可以发现产品在运行过程中存在的瓶颈。例如,当发现响应时间过长时,可以针对性地优化代码、调整系统配置或升级硬件设备,从而提高产品性能。
- 评估产品改进效果
在产品迭代过程中,对改进措施进行性能测试,可以评估改进效果。通过对比改进前后的性能指标,可以直观地了解改进措施对产品性能的提升程度。
- 指导产品优化方向
性能指标可以帮助产品团队了解用户在使用过程中的痛点,从而有针对性地进行产品优化。例如,当发现并发用户数较低时,可以优化产品功能,提高用户粘性,从而增加并发用户数。
- 预测产品发展趋势
通过对历史性能指标进行分析,可以预测产品未来的发展趋势。例如,当发现用户数量呈上升趋势时,可以提前规划硬件设备升级、优化系统架构等,以确保产品能够满足未来用户的需求。
- 保障产品质量
性能指标是衡量产品质量的重要标准。在产品迭代过程中,通过持续关注性能指标,可以及时发现产品质量问题,并采取措施进行修复,确保产品质量。
三、案例分析
以某电商平台为例,该平台在迭代过程中,通过关注以下性能指标,实现了产品性能的持续优化:
- 响应时间:通过优化前端代码、调整服务器配置,将响应时间从2秒降低到1秒。
- 吞吐量:通过升级服务器硬件、优化数据库查询,将吞吐量从每秒处理1000个请求提升到每秒处理2000个请求。
- 并发用户数:通过优化系统架构、增加服务器资源,将并发用户数从1000人提升到5000人。
通过持续关注这些性能指标,该电商平台在迭代过程中实现了产品性能的显著提升,从而为用户提供更好的购物体验。
总之,性能指标在产品迭代过程中具有至关重要的作用。通过关注和分析性能指标,可以帮助产品团队发现产品瓶颈、评估改进效果、指导产品优化方向、预测发展趋势,并保障产品质量。在未来的产品迭代过程中,性能指标将继续发挥其重要作用。
猜你喜欢:云原生可观测性